Dhar, P. K.
Pradyut Kumar Dhar is a research officer in the HPCL R&D hydroprocessing group. His experience includes the commissioning of isotherming technology at the HPCL Mumbai refinery, and his areas of interest include process intensification and technology development in the area of hydroprocessing. Mr. Dhar completed his B.Tech degree in chemical engineering from Jadavpur University, Kolkata, India and an M.Tech degree in chemical engineering from the Indian Institute of Technology (IIT), Kanpur, India, where he was awarded an Academic Excellence Award in 2011.
